Transaction 34311728ff59bd4f3c6715091b9a541335f350176b32b6b048802a097c7564e8

block
b29438f51ab07f80fb778279f8c4b409ac860b728707a7bc7f35b77f9f48fe78

12 Inputs

6 Outputs